Revlon 12 Hour Color Stay Eyeshadow Quads Review

Welcome back my fellow readers to another post. Today I am going to make it a quick review on the Revlon 12 Hour Color Stay Eyeshadow Quads. I have had these babies for a long time now, and they always come through to what I need them to do.

Of course the packaging has changed a bit from when I purchased mine, but still the Revlon shadows are always a good product in my eyes.

You can get these quads at any drug store, Target, Ulta, Wal Mart etc.

The pigmentation on these quads are great. They are easy to blend, and the lasting power on them is fabulous. The 12 hour statement is true. As long as you use a primer underneath you should be good. Sometimes you may find that the shadows give off a little bit of fall out, which you can't really complain about for the price you are paying for them. Aside of the fall out in certain shades these quads are great for everyday use.

The 3 palettes I have are #1 Copper Spice, I have been using this one all throughout October. #5 Blushed Wines is my second favorite. Both these palettes I have used throughout October since they give such great neutral looks.  The last palette I have is #10 Berry Bloom. This quad I do not use as often as the first two because this quad has more vibrant punch colors I can not wear in the office.

I have had some eyeshadow looks with these quads in my previous YouTube videos. Go check out my YouTube channel for swatches on these quads.  MacGirl25Antonietta

Now the price point is fairly reasonable. Each quad is around $8-$14. Which is great considering the high end palettes go no more then $40plus. To make this better Revlon goes on sale all the time so you could probably pick these up for cheaper as well.

#1 Copper Spice quad is very similar to the Urban Decay Naked Basics Palette. So if you do not want to go out and buy the $30 Urban Decay Naked Basics palette. This Revlon quad is a fabulous option.

End of October Beauty Empties 2013

Ola Beauty Lovers! I know its been a minute since I have been on here. I have been posting on my YouTube Channel: MacGirl25Antonietta more frequent then my blog. I am sorry just been catching up on my day time job and some personal issues I am going through.

Today I am here to show you my end of October Beauty Empties. I am so excited to get rid of these empties since they have been sitting in my room for some time now. Let's jump in.

1. Equate Cotton pads
- Bought these at Wal Mart for $2 and you get 150 cotton pads. They do the job to remove eye makeup or even nail polish. For so cheap you can not go wrong! Great product.


















2. Origins Gin Zing Eye Cream (Sample size)
- Got this sample from Sephora, tried it under my eyes at night to hydrate. The label claims it should brighten and de-puff, but all it really did for me was hydrate. I did not notice any de-puffing or brightening going on. I doubt I'll buy this in full size.



3. Balea Detoxifying Face Mask
- Love this line of at home face masks. I buy mine at Shoppers Drug Mart for 3 for $5. They have a whole bunch of scents and different purpose masks. Great way to spend your evenings un-winding from a hectic day. I will always re purchase these.



4. Givenchy for Her Fragrance (Sample Size)
- I enjoyed this sample size of the Givenchy for her. It has a sweet smell but not over powering at all.
Don't you just hate when you get headaches from strong perfume? Well this does not do that at all. Once I finish a couple of my regular size bottles of perfume I do believe I will be picking this one up. I have one more sample of this one and I have been savoring it :)



5. Ardel Runway Fancy and Fashion 111 Lashes
- I have been trying to use more false lashes lately. With Halloween that just passed I used the Runway Fancy ones for that. The Fashion 111 lashes I re used a few times since they are reusable as long as you take care of them. The Runway Fancy lashes were horrible. They had the worst band on them that they irritated my lash line. The Fashion lashes were a lot better, their band was thin and clear so it did not irritate me at all. I just stocked up on the lashes from Ardel, the natural/fashion ones since their bands are more wearable then those runway line is. Ardel Lashes are pretty affordable. Sally's Beauty Supply has them for about $6 and sometimes you can find them on sale for 2 for $5!




6. 2 of the Silk Elements Olive Conditioner
- You guys have seen these in my empties time and time again. I get them at Sally's Beauty Supply, usually they are on sale for $0.99 which is a great deal. I have a few more to get through but I always enjoy this conditioner as everyday conditioner. Hydrates amazing and does not leave my hair greasy.



7. John Masters Organics Lavender Rosemary Shampoo
- I found this line on Nailpolishcanada.com. I thought I would try it out since it is organic, no parabens, no sulfate, no chemicals. The shampoo was $16. I loved the smell of the Lavender and Rosemary however I did not find that this shampoo really cleaned my hair. No it's not about the lathering for me. It's about when I get out of the shower and dry my hair I notice my hair is still a tad oily and it drove me up the bloody wall. I used so much of the shampoo to ensure I covered all my head and still it did not cleanse how I wanted it. Definite fail for me. Not worth the $16.



8. Bath & Body Works Candle in Harvest Gathering scent
- Got this medium size candle for Bath & Body Works for free after spending a certain amount of money. It was a great scent, I enjoyed it so much. I now started burning the large fall scent candles I have purchased from there. Yummmmy.



9. Yves Rocher Coconut lip balm
- Had this lip balm in my collection for a few years, worked hard to finish it because I could not stand the consistency of the balm. It was in a pot which is hard to work with because you don't want to get your hands dirty plus the balm itself felt gritty on my lips. Not refreshing at all. Thank God it's done. Will not repurchase that every again. I don't even know if they still make that line.


10. Growth Spurt Base Coat
-Finally readers this is my last empties for the end of October. This is my ultimate favorite nail polish base coat to strengthen and lengthen your nails. You can find this at Sally's Beauty Supply for $8 - $9 each. Love this stuff so much I stock up with back ups. My nails have chipped and split on the sides from stress and weather change that I had to cut them all short. This base coat is a miracle worker!
